Teacher of ICT and Business Studies job summary
We are looking for a Part-Time Teacher of ICT and Business Studies with the drive and experience to ensure that our students make even further progress over the coming years and to improve Progress 8 outcomes of all students. Computer Science is taught in Key Stage 3 and is an option at Key Stage 4. Students also take a vocational ICT course during Key Stage 4. The ability to deliver some GCSE Business Studies would be an advantage.

Our Academy is an 11--‐16 mixed comprehensive school and we currently have 1030 students. Our intake is non--‐selective and varied, including children from a wide range of homes and backgrounds. We pride ourselves in our inclusive approach, but we never compromise on high expectations.
There has never been a better time to seek employment at The Winsford Academy, as we share a strong, dynamic sponsorship arrangement with the highly regarded and outstanding Fallibroome Multi Academy Trust, based in Macclesfield. The school is one of the founding members of the Fallibroome Trust and there are opportunities for development and collaboration across the Trust.
